    Growing Applications in Pharmaceuticals

    The pharmaceutical sector significantly influences the Global Marine Biotechnology Market Industry, as marine organisms are a rich source of bioactive compounds with therapeutic potential. Marine-derived drugs, such as those sourced from sponges and corals, have shown efficacy in treating various diseases, including cancer and inflammatory disorders. The increasing prevalence of chronic diseases globally drives the demand for novel pharmaceuticals, further propelling the market. As research uncovers more marine-derived compounds, the pharmaceutical industry is likely to expand its reliance on marine biotechnology, contributing to the projected market growth to 12.5 USD Billion by 2035.

    Marine Biotechnology Market Application Insights

    The Global Marine Biotechnology Market's application segment encompasses various critical industries, reflecting a robust growth trajectory driven by innovation and demand for natural products. As of 2024, the pharmaceuticals application stands out with a valuation of 2.45 USD Billion, dominating the segment due to the increasing reliance on marine-derived compounds for drug discovery and development, particularly for therapeutic treatments.

    Nutraceuticals follow, valued at 1.5 USD Billion, with a significant interest in supplements derived from marine sources that offer health benefits, catering to the growing consumer awareness regarding wellness and preventive healthcare. The cosmetics sector, valued at 1.12 USD Billion in 2024, emphasizes the utilization of marine ingredients like algae and other natural extracts, which are valued for their potential anti-aging properties and skin health benefits, further enhancing their appeal in beauty products.

    In the agricultural space, this market is estimated at 0.75 USD Billion, focusing on biostimulants and biofertilizers derived from marine biotechnology that improve crop yield and sustainability in farming practices, aligning with the global push towards more environmentally-friendly agricultural methods.

    The biofuels application, although the smallest with a valuation of 0.75 USD Billion, plays a crucial role in addressing energy needs through sustainable sources, tapping marine biomass for energy production, and contributing to the decreasing carbon footprint. Each of these applications enhances the Global Marine Biotechnology Market revenue, illustrating diverse growth opportunities while addressing contemporary challenges in health, agriculture, and renewable energy.

    Regional Insights

    The Global Marine Biotechnology Market is experiencing substantial growth across various regions, with North America leading in market valuation. In 2024, North America is valued at 2.1 USD Billion, which is expected to reach 4.0 USD Billion by 2035, showcasing its majority holding in the market.

    Europe follows as a significant region worth 1.8 USD Billion in 2024, projected to grow to 3.5 USD Billion by 2035, driven by advances in bioprocessing. The APAC region, valued at 1.5 USD Billion in 2024, also exhibits strong potential with an anticipated increase to 2.8 USD Billion by 2035, influenced by rising investments in marine resources.South America, though smaller, with a valuation of 0.85 USD Billion in 2024, is expected to double to 1.7 USD Billion by 2035, indicating emerging opportunities in marine bioproducts.

    Lastly, the MEA region, at 0.32 USD Billion in 2024, is projected to reach 0.5 USD Billion by 2035, representing a nascent yet growing interest in marine biotechnology. Together, these regions portray the diverse dynamics and opportunities within the Global Marine Biotechnology Market, shaped by varying local developments and the discovery of new marine resources.

    Industry Developments

    • Q2 2024: Veramaris and ADM Announce Strategic Partnership to Expand Omega-3 Production from Algae Veramaris, a leader in algae-based omega-3 production, entered a strategic partnership with ADM to scale up sustainable omega-3 fatty acid production for aquaculture and pet nutrition using marine biotechnology.
    • Q1 2024: AlgaEnergy and Laboratoires Expanscience Sign Agreement to Develop Marine-Based Cosmetic Ingredients AlgaEnergy, a biotechnology company specializing in microalgae, signed a collaboration agreement with Laboratoires Expanscience to co-develop new marine-derived ingredients for the cosmetics sector.
    • Q2 2024: Marinomed Biotech AG Receives European Patent for Carragelose-Based Antiviral Nasal Spray Marinomed Biotech AG announced the grant of a European patent for its Carragelose-based nasal spray, a marine-derived antiviral product, strengthening its intellectual property portfolio in marine biotechnology.
    • Q1 2024: Aker BioMarine Launches New Krill-Derived Protein Ingredient for Functional Foods Aker BioMarine introduced a new krill protein ingredient designed for use in functional foods, expanding its marine biotechnology product portfolio.
    • Q2 2024: BlueNalu Secures $33.5 Million in Series B Funding to Advance Cell-Cultured Seafood BlueNalu, a pioneer in cell-cultured seafood, raised $33.5 million in Series B funding to accelerate commercialization of its marine biotechnology-based seafood products.
    • Q1 2024: Ocean Harvest Technology Appoints New CEO to Drive Global Expansion Ocean Harvest Technology, a company specializing in marine algae-based animal feed, appointed a new CEO to lead its next phase of international growth.
    • Q2 2024: Corbion Opens New Algae Ingredients Production Facility in the United States Corbion inaugurated a new production facility dedicated to algae-based ingredients, enhancing its capacity to supply marine biotechnology products for food and feed applications.
    • Q1 2024: Algama Foods Raises €13 Million to Scale Up Microalgae-Based Food Ingredients Algama Foods, a French startup focused on microalgae-based food ingredients, secured €13 million in funding to expand production and accelerate product development.
    • Q2 2024: Seventure Partners Invests in Microphyt to Boost Microalgae Production for Nutraceuticals Seventure Partners made a strategic investment in Microphyt, a marine biotechnology company, to support the scale-up of microalgae production for nutraceutical applications.
    • Q1 2024: PharmaMar Receives FDA Orphan Drug Designation for Lurbinectedin in Ewing Sarcoma PharmaMar, a marine biotechnology company, received Orphan Drug Designation from the U.S. FDA for its marine-derived compound lurbinectedin for the treatment of Ewing sarcoma.
    • Q2 2024: AlgaeCytes Announces Construction of New Algae Production Facility in Germany AlgaeCytes, a producer of high-value algae-derived ingredients, began construction of a new production facility in Germany to meet growing demand in the nutraceutical and cosmetic sectors.
    • Q1 2024: Aquasearch Appoints Chief Scientific Officer to Lead Marine Bioproducts R&D Aquasearch, a marine biotechnology company, appointed a new Chief Scientific Officer to oversee research and development of novel marine bioproducts.
